Product Manager of Data
- Define and champion a clear product vision and roadmap for the Data Platform, aligning with Metrc’s business objectives, regulatory requirements, and customer needs.
- Partner with the Director of Data Platform and CTO to ensure data products support both external customers and internal teams (Sales, Customer Success, Senior Leadership).
- Conduct market research, competitive analysis, and customer feedback to identify opportunities and validate data product ideas in the cannabis industry.
- Translate business needs into detailed product requirements, specifications, and user stories, working closely with data engineers, BI specialists, and technical product managers.
- Lead cross-functional teams (Data, Engineering, Design, Marketing) to deliver high-quality data products, including dashboards, reports, and analytics solutions, on time and within budget.
- Oversee the integration of data lake technologies (Snowflake, Databricks, Domo, Tableau) and potentially transactional databases (SQL Server, PostgreSQL, MongoDB) to ensure seamless data flows and usability.
- Prioritize and manage the product backlog, balancing regulatory compliance, customer demands, and internal stakeholder needs with long-term platform scalability.
- Serve as the voice of the customer, ensuring data products address pain points for external users (state regulators, cannabis businesses) and internal teams.
- Communicate product vision, strategy, and progress to stakeholders, including senior leadership, customers, and development teams, to align expectations and drive adoption.
- Collaborate with Customer Success Managers and Customer Support to develop go-to-market strategies and support customer onboarding for data products.
- Define and monitor key product success metrics (e.g., adoption, retention, customer NPS, data query performance) to drive continuous improvement.
- Leverage analytics and KPIs to optimize data product performance and user satisfaction, ensuring compliance with cannabis industry regulations.
- Stay current with industry trends, data technologies, and regulatory changes to enhance the Data Platform’s capabilities.
